Hyundai Car Key Replacement: What Makes These Keys Different

Hyundai has used rolling-code transponder technology since the early 2000s, meaning the key's embedded chip must be electronically paired to the vehicle's immobilizer module — a simple cut key will crank nothing. Newer models like the Elantra HEV and Tucson Hybrid add another layer with Hyundai's proximity smart key system, where the car detects the fob in your pocket and allows push-button start. Losing or damaging one of these keys is not as simple as duplicating a house key; the replacement requires both precision cutting and live programming using OBD-linked equipment.

Locked Out of Your Hyundai? Here Is What to Do First

If you find yourself with Hyundai Elantra locked keys in car, or a similar situation with a Santa Fe, Sonata, or Tucson, resist the temptation to try improvised entry methods. Forcing a door, using a makeshift slim jim, or wedging a window can trigger airbag sensors, damage weather stripping, or bend a door frame — repairs that cost far more than a professional lockout service. Instead, check whether another door is unlocked, look for a stored spare with a family member, or see whether your vehicle's Hyundai Blue Link app can send a remote unlock command if your account is active.

Can you make a replacement key if I have lost every key to my Hyundai?+

Yes. Lost-all-keys situations are one of the more complex jobs we handle, but our technicians are equipped for it. When no working key remains, programming a new key requires bypassing the vehicle's existing key memory and initializing a fresh pairing between the new key and the immobilizer. We do this on-site using OBD-linked programming tools and VIN-based key code retrieval, so a tow to the dealership is usually unnecessary.
